EXCEEDS logo
Exceeds
rylan-geykhman

PROFILE

Rylan-geykhman

John Smith contributed to the sitechtimes/regents-prep-app-frontend by developing and refining authentication workflows and enhancing the Student Portal’s user experience. He centralized user authentication initialization using middleware in Vue.js and Nuxt.js, resolving race conditions and ensuring protected routes only load after user state is ready. In addition, he implemented logout and authentication state management with login redirection, and laid the foundation for future account settings features. John also delivered a comprehensive UI/UX refresh, introducing dark mode and improving navigation, theming, and assignment workflows. His work demonstrated depth in frontend development, state management, and CSS, resulting in a more reliable application.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

9Total
Bugs
0
Commits
9
Features
3
Lines of code
4,249
Activity Months2

Your Network

5 people

Work History

November 2024

4 Commits • 2 Features

Nov 1, 2024

November 2024 (2024-11) monthly summary for sitechtimes/regents-prep-app-frontend: Key features delivered include a robust logout and authentication state management workflow with login redirection and groundwork for an account-settings dropdown, plus a comprehensive UI/UX refresh across the Student Portal with dark mode, improved navigation after login, and enhanced Join Class and course/assignment experiences. Major fixes include resolving theming inconsistencies and UI regressions, stabilizing navigation flows, and preparing a test backend URL environment to support staging. The work reduces user friction, improves consistency, and aligns with the design system, enabling smoother onboarding and fewer support tickets. Technologies/skills demonstrated include React-based frontend work, state management, routing, theming and dark mode, UI/UX design, and environment configuration for testing.

October 2024

5 Commits • 1 Features

Oct 1, 2024

October 2024 monthly summary for sitechtimes/regents-prep-app-frontend: Focused on stabilizing user authentication initialization to prevent race conditions and improve reliability of protected routes. Implemented middleware-driven initialization that waits for user data before auth checks, and consolidated initialization flow. Applied a sequence of fixes across five commits to ensure consistent behavior and remove noisy logging.

Activity

Loading activity data...

Quality Metrics

Correctness82.2%
Maintainability84.4%
Architecture73.4%
Performance80.0%
AI Usage24.4%

Skills & Technologies

Programming Languages

CSSJavaScriptTypeScriptVue

Technical Skills

CSSFrontend DevelopmentMiddlewareNuxt.jsRoutingState ManagementUI/UXUI/UX EnhancementVue.js

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

sitechtimes/regents-prep-app-frontend

Oct 2024 Nov 2024
2 Months active

Languages Used

JavaScriptTypeScriptCSSVue

Technical Skills

Frontend DevelopmentMiddlewareNuxt.jsState ManagementVue.jsCSS

Generated by Exceeds AIThis report is designed for sharing and indexing